Responsibilities:

Policy Research and Analysis

  • Conduct research and analysis of legislative initiatives, regulatory actions, and government programs related to transportation, tolling, and mobility.
  • Monitor and evaluate the impact of federal and state policy developments on the industry.
  • Develop briefing materials, policy summaries, memos, and fact sheets for internal and external audiences.
  • Assist in crafting advocacy messages and communications for policymakers and industry stakeholders.

Member and Stakeholder Engagement

  • Coordinate outreach to member organizations to gather industry insights and case studies through surveys, interviews, and continuous engagement.
  • Track input and actions from members to support policy development.
  • Monitor and engage with peer associations and advocacy groups to identify collaboration opportunities.
  • Stay informed on relevant research and academic studies to enhance information sharing and policy influence.

Committee and Event Support

  • Attend and report on industry meetings, congressional hearings, and webinars.
  • Help organize and support member meetings with government officials and agencies.
  • Assist in the operations of various committees and task forces by preparing materials, scheduling meetings, and maintaining engagement.

Writing and Communication

  • Draft content for reports, presentations, newsletters, and talking points.
  • Create and manage policy-related content for digital platforms and assist with media outreach efforts.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Public Policy, Transportation, Urban Planning, Political Science, Economics, Business, or a related field.
  • 1–2 years of experience in policy research, government relations, or nonprofit/public sector roles.
  • Strong analytical and research skills with the ability to simplify complex information.
  • Excellent writing, communication, and time management skills.
  • Self-motivated, detail-oriented, and capable of managing multiple projects simultaneously.
  • Ability to engage effectively with diverse stakeholders and work independently or in a team setting.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).
  • Familiarity with transportation operations or public policy is a plus.
